Bajaj Pulsar 220 Powerhouse of Performance

At the heart of the Bajaj Pulsar 220 lies a potent engine that truly sets it apart. With a best-in-class 15 kW (20.4 PS) of power and 18.55 Nm of torque, this motorcycle ensures an exhilarating riding experience. The Twin Spark FI DTS-i Engine not only provides impressive performance but also delivers efficiency, making it an ideal choice for both city commutes and highway cruises.

Bajaj Pulsar 220 Safety at Its Core

Safety is paramount, and the Bajaj Pulsar 220 doesn’t disappoint. Equipped with 280 mm front and 230 mm rear disc brakes, it offers superior stopping power, enhancing rider confidence on the road. The inclusion of Single Channel ABS further elevates the safety quotient. Keeping riders informed is the digital odometer and speedometer, offering real-time data for a secure journey.

Smooth Transmission and Handling

The Bajaj Pulsar 220 features a 5-speed manual transmission, ensuring seamless gear shifts and optimal control. With a kerb weight of 160 kg, it strikes a balance between stability and maneuverability. The 15-liter fuel tank capacity allows for extended rides without frequent refueling stops.

Bajaj Pulsar 220 Affordable Luxury

The price of the Bajaj Pulsar 220 stands at an attractive 1.38 lakh rupees. For those looking to make their dream of owning this iconic motorcycle a reality, EMI options start from just Rs. 4,756, making it accessible to a wide range of riders. Furthermore, Bajaj offers a manufacturer warranty of 5 years or 75,000 km, exemplifying their confidence in the bike’s durability and performance.

The Old Meets the New

While the Bajaj Pulsar 220 undoubtedly has an enduring charm, it retains a styling that has remained relatively unchanged for a decade. For riders seeking a more modern touch, the absence of features like Bluetooth connectivity may be a drawback. However, for many, the bike’s classic design is part of its timeless appeal.

Bajaj Pulsar 220 is soon launching as a new model with powerful features and a sporty look. The bike will have an analog dial, semi-digital instrument console, fuel level indicator, speedometer, and a digital screen. It will also come with features like telescopic forks and dual gas-charged shock absorbers. The bike will have a 220cc single-cylinder, air-cooled, fuel-injected engine. The engine will produce a maximum power of 20bhp and a torque of 18.5 Nm. The bike will have a 5-speed gearbox and will be updated according to the new BS6 Phase-2 RDE norms. The bike runs on E-20 petrol and has a mileage of 40 kmpl. The ex-showroom price of the bike is 1.40 lakh rupees, which is 3000 rupees higher than the previous model. It will compete with bikes like Apache RTR 200 4V in the Indian market.
